Understanding Johnny Cash’s Influence on Music

Johnny Cash’s influence on the music industry is profound and multifaceted. He is renowned for his unique musical style that incorporates elements of country, rockabilly, blues, and folk. Beginning his career in the 1950s, Cash helped popularize the genres of country and rock music. His storytelling approach, which often included elements of social commentary, resonated with listeners who found comfort and connection in his lyrics. Songs like “Folsom Prison Blues” and “Ring of Fire” not only topped charts but also became anthems for personal freedom and struggle.

Moreover, Cash’s willingness to address themes of social justice, such as poverty and the plight of the marginalized, positioned him as an artist willing to speak truth to power. His collaborations with artists from diverse genres, including Bob Dylan and U2, further expanded his impact, enabling him to reach audiences who may not have initially identified as country music fans.

Milestones in Johnny Cash’s Career

Throughout his lengthy career, Johnny Cash achieved numerous milestones that solidified his status as a music icon. His debut album, “With His Hot and Blue Guitar,” released in 1957, marked the beginning of a remarkable journey that included a series of chart-topping hits and several Grammy Awards. One of his most notable achievements was his performance at Folsom Prison in 1968, which not only revitalized his career but also highlighted the human experience behind bars and garnered immense media attention.

In addition to his musical success, Cash also made contributions to television and film. His television show, “The Johnny Cash Show,” featured diverse artists and became a cultural phenomenon in the late 1960s and early 1970s. Films depicting his life and music, such as “Walk the Line,” further cemented his legacy, allowing new generations to discover his artistry.
